Why Access Matters

The reality:

Many kids, teens, and families need therapy long before they can comfortably afford it. Insurance gaps, high deductibles, and limited in-network options mean that families either wait, piece things together, or go without.

At Thayer OPS, roughly half of our clinical hours are reserved for reduced-fee or pro bono care. That isn’t a side project. It’s central to why this practice exists.

To make that sustainable, we invite individuals and local businesses to help fund care directly. When you sponsor sessions, you are quite literally buying someone time to help themselves.

For clients & families

 If you’re seeking therapy and worried about cost:

  • We offer reduced fee options for a portion of our weekly spots.
  • We also hold a small number of pro bono (no-fee) slots for situations where payment isn’t possible.

If cost is your biggest barrier, please still reach out. You can note that in the contact form, and we’ll let you know what’s currently available.

For sponsors & businesses

If you’re an individual, business, or organization that cares about youth mental health, you can sponsor therapy directly.

Sponsored funds go to:

  • Reduced-fee or pro bono sessions for youth and families
  • Occasional group offerings for teens and parents
  • Brief stabilization and follow-up care for high-risk situations

We do not use sponsorship money for unrelated business expenses. Sponsorship is about paying for time in the room.

How sponsorship works

Here’s the basic structure:

  1. You choose an amount or level.
    You can fund a single session, a block of sessions, or a recurring monthly amount.
  2. Funds are held in a dedicated account.
    We track sponsored funds separately and apply them only to approved reduced-fee/pro bono sessions.
  3. Sessions are matched with need.
    When a client qualifies for reduced or no-fee care, sponsored funds help cover all or part of their time.
  4. You receive a simple acknowledgment.
    We’ll send a receipt and, if you’d like, a brief summary of how your sponsorship was used in general terms (never with identifying info).

If you’re a business, we can also list your name or logo as a community sponsor on our website, with your permission.

Sample sponsorship levels

 Examples of what your sponsorship can approximately do:

  • $185 – helps cover one therapy session for a youth or family.
  • $740 – supports a month of weekly therapy for one teen or young adult.
  • $1,850 – helps fund a full course of short-term trauma-focused care for a youth or family (about 10 sessions).
  • $3,000 – supports a mix of assessment, therapy, and follow-up for multiple families over the year.

Custom amount – we’ll work with you if you have a specific goal or population in mind.

Sponsorship FAQ

Right now, Thayer OPS is a private practice, not a nonprofit organization. That means sponsorships are typically not tax-deductible donations in the way gifts to a 501(c)(3) would be. Businesses can sometimes treat sponsorship as a business expense; please check with your tax professional.

Non-profit status, or some other appropriate structure, is currently a work in progress.
